Mesa Leadership Class of 2025 has selected a project to install a sail shade structure, seating, and trash receptacles near the new soccer field at the Ross Farnsworth–East Valley YMCA, 1807 S. Sunview in Mesa.
The class will hold its first fundraising event Saturday, Feb. 8, at The Post, 26 N. MacDonald, in Mesa.
The Ross Farnsworth–East Valley Family YMCA opened in October of 2009. The new soccer field is the first of many outdoor recreational/athletic activities to be placed on land adjacent to the YMCA that was donated by AT Still University. The soccer field turf was donated by the Arizona Cardinals NFL team and installed by the YMCA. Development of a master plan to add additional recreational opportunities will be undertaken in the near future, according to officials.
Mesa Leadership Class of 2025 chose for their class project to provide a shade structure and seating that can be used by players during practice as well as families and friends supporting soccer players at practices and games. Trash receptacles will provide adequate facilities for those using the field to dispose of cups, wrappers, etc. to keep the area clear of debris and assist in the maintenance and proper upkeep of the field.
In addition, youth who participate in the YMCA childcare programs will use the field as well as the shade and seating provided by this project, which will better serve them, according to project leaders, adding that their target fundraising goal is $25,000.

The Mesa Leadership Training & Development Program was inaugurated in 1981 with the belief that every community has potential leaders who are seeking the opportunity to serve and who need the exposure to the information, organizations and leaders to make that service possible.
The Mesa Leadership Training & Development Program is a nonprofit 501(c)(3) organization, sponsored by the Mesa Chamber of Commerce. The program is administered by volunteers who serve as board members, program and curriculum development committees, and community liaisons.
